
The courts have generally held that direct taxes are restricted to taxes on people (variously called capitation, poll tax or head tax) and property. (Penn Mutual Indemnity Corp. v. C.I.R., 227 F.2d 16, anjing 19-20 (3rd Cir. 1960).) Various other taxes are known as “indirect taxes,” because they tax an event, rather than human being or property as such. (Steward Machine Co. v. Davis, 301 U.S. 548, 581-582 (1937).) What turned out to be a straightforward limitation on the power of the legislature based on the subject of the tax proved inexact and unclear when applied for income tax, that will be arguably viewed either as a direct or an indirect tax.
